A person who makes, manufactures, or works with cardboard boxes and cartonnage materials.
From French cartonnier (from carton plus the agent suffix '-nier,' similar to English '-er'), describing someone who works in the cardboard and box-making industry.
The French suffix '-nier' creates job titles like 'cartonnier,' 'drapier' (cloth maker), or 'canonnier' (cannoneer)—it's a elegant way to turn a material into the person who works with it, and English speakers often use these French occupational words.
